SourceForge Submitter: mmoulton .
I recently configured JBoss-3.2.3RC1-jetty-4.2.14, after
getting everything running for my environment I am
getting a "java.lang.IllegalStateException: No 'jboss'
MBeanServer found!" when I try to access the jmx-console.
After a bunch of troubleshooting I have narrowed the
problem down to 1 area.
For some apps I run, I need the
Java2ClassLoadingCompliance attribute in jetty's jboss-
service.xml set to false. To do this I unpacked the .sar as
it is not unpacked by default in this build. I then made my
change to the jboss-service.xml where appropriate. After I
make this change I am unable to access the jmx-console;
while prior to the change, everything works fine.
I narrowed the problem down to a jboss-jmx.jar located in
the jmx-console.war. When I removed this jar everything
seems to work fine.
OS: Mac OS X 10.3.1
JDK: 1.4.1
